jQuery是一种在Web开发中最常用的JavaScript库之一,它包含了大量的方法和函数,可以帮助我们实现各种功能和效果。其中,numeral方法是一个非常常用的数字格式化方法,可以让数字更易读、更美观。
numeral方法可以将数字格式化为货币、百分比、日期等不同类型的格式。使用方法十分简单,在调用jQuery之后,我们只需要创建一个变量,并将要格式化的数字传入numeral方法的参数中即可:
var num = 123456789; var formattedNum = numeral(num).format('$0,0.00'); console.log(formattedNum); // $123,456,789.00
在上面的例子中,我们首先定义了一个变量num,它的值为123456789。然后,我们调用numeral方法将这个数字格式化为货币类型,并使用格式字符串'$0,0.00'指定了格式化的方式。最后,我们将格式化后的字符串输出到控制台中。
numeral方法支持的格式字符串非常丰富,可以实现各种不同的格式化效果。下面是一些常用的格式字符串示例:
var num = 0.123456789; console.log(numeral(num).format('0%')); // 12% console.log(numeral(num).format('0.00%')); // 12.35% console.log(numeral(num).format('$0,0.00')); // $0.12 console.log(numeral(num).format('(0.00)')); // (0.12) console.log(numeral(1000).format('0a')); // 1k console.log(numeral(1000000).format('0,0a')); // 1,000k console.log(numeral(1234.56).format('0.00')); // 1234.56 console.log(numeral(1234.56).format('00.0000')); // 1234.5600 console.log(numeral(1234.56).format('0[.]00')); // 1234.56 console.log(numeral(1234.56).format('0.0')); // 1234.6 console.log(numeral(1234.56).format('0.0[000]')); // 1234.56 console.log(numeral(1111).format('0a')); // 1.1k console.log(numeral(11111).format('0a')); // 11.1k
如上所示,numeral方法可以实现各种不同类型的数字格式化。它的使用非常方便,可以帮助我们节省大量的时间和精力。在开发Web应用时,我们可以根据具体需求选择不同的格式化方式,让数字更美观、更易读。